Featuring a binder-free borosilicate glass microfiber depth medium, these 25mm filter discs deliver 1.0um nominal particle retention with a 99.998% DOP retention rating for demanding air monitoring and analytical work. The 100% borosilicate construction contains no binders, eliminating binder extractables during solvent filtration and gravimetric analysis. With a media thickness of 700um, the depth structure provides high particulate loading capacity combined with low filter resistance, making it well suited to heavily loaded samples and high flow rates. Key Glass Fiber Media Characteristics
- Hydrophilic depth medium: The 100% borosilicate glass microfiber structure wets readily and captures particles throughout its depth rather than at a single surface plane.
- 1.0um nominal retention: Provides fine nominal particle retention with a 99.998% DOP retention efficiency, not an absolute pore size rating.
- Binder-free composition: Contains no bonding resin, avoiding binder extractables that can interfere with gravimetric and analytical determinations.
- High particulate loading: The large internal surface area provides outstanding impurity retention capacity while maintaining low filter resistance.
- Thermally robust: Binder-free borosilicate glass microfiber withstands temperatures up to 500 degrees C, supporting high-temperature gravimetric procedures.

This depth medium delivers consistent, reproducible retention for air pollution monitoring, suspended solids analysis, and sample prefiltration. The binder-free borosilicate composition preserves sample integrity in gravimetric and trace analytical work where extractables must be minimized. Used as a prefilter, it extends the service life of downstream membranes by capturing heavy particulate loads upstream.

- Air Pollution Monitoring The binder-free borosilicate medium captures airborne particulates for gravimetric determination and atmospheric pollution control measurements.
- Suspended Solids Analysis The 1.0um nominal retention depth medium collects suspended solids in water, wastewater, and industrial samples for gravimetric quantification.
- Gravimetric Analysis The binder-free composition avoids extractables, supporting accurate weight-based analytical determinations.
- Membrane Prefiltration Used upstream of a final membrane, the high-loading depth medium traps coarse particulates to extend downstream filter life.
- Sample Clarification The depth structure provides low-cost clarification of heavily loaded aqueous samples ahead of analysis.
- Solvent Filtration The binder-free borosilicate matrix filters solvents without introducing resin extractables into the filtrate.
